Ingredients for No Bake Turtle Mini Cheesecake

Okay, let’s get down to the good stuff – what you’ll need to make these incredible mini cheesecakes! The beauty of this recipe is that it uses pretty standard ingredients, but getting them ready just right makes all the difference. Here’s my go-to list:

No Bake Turtle Mini Cheesecake - detail 1

  • 1 1/2 cups graham cracker crumbs: Make sure they’re finely crushed! I just whiz them in my food processor until they’re like fine sand.
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ar: Just a little sweetness for our crust.
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ted and cooled: Melting it is easy, but let it cool for a few minutes so it doesn’t make your crumbs soggy.
  • 16 ounces full-fat cream cheese, softened to room temperature: This is CRUCIAL for a smooth, lump-free filling. Don’t skip letting it soften!
  • 1 cup powdered sugar, sifted: Sifting prevents any pesky lumps in your creamy filling.
  • 1 teaspoon alcohol-free vanilla extract: For that lovely, warm vanilla note.
  • 1 cup heavy cream, chilled: Keep it cold until you’re ready to whip it – it makes a huge difference!
  • 1/2 cup caramel sauce, store-bought or homemade: Whatever your heart desires!
  • 1/4 cup chocolate syrup: The more chocolate, the merrier, I say!
  • 1/4 cup pecans, finely chopped: These add that perfect, buttery crunch.

Preparing the Delicious No Bake Turtle Mini Cheesecake Crust

First things first, let’s get that amazing crust ready! In a medium bowl, you’ll want to combine your finely crushed graham cracker crumbs with the granulated sugar. Give it a good stir. Then, pour in your cooled melted butter and mix it all up until it looks like wet sand. Now, spoon this mixture into your mini cheesecake pans or cupcake liners, about a tablespoon or so each. Press it down firmly with the back of a spoon or your fingers – you want a nice, compact base here!

Crafting the Creamy No Bake Turtle Mini Cheesecake Filling

This is the heart of our cheesecake! In a large bowl, beat your softened cream cheese with the powdered sugar and alcohol-free vanilla extract until it’s super smooth and creamy, with no lumps in sight. Seriously, beat it well! In a separate, chilled bowl, whip your heavy cream until it forms beautiful, stiff peaks. This is important for that light, airy texture. Now, gently fold the whipped cream into your cream cheese mixture. Be delicate here; we want to keep all that lovely air we just whipped in!

Chilling and Topping Your No Bake Turtle Mini Cheesecake

Once your filling is ready, spoon it evenly over your prepared crusts in the pans. Smooth out the tops with a spatula. Now, for the hardest part: waiting! Cover your cheesecakes loosely with plastic wrap and pop them in the fridge for at least 4 hours. I usually aim for overnight if I can; they get even firmer and more delicious. Once they’re perfectly chilled and firm, it’s time for the grand finale! Drizzle them generously with caramel sauce and chocolate syrup, then sprinkle those chopped pecans all over. Voila! Tips for Perfect No Bake Turtle Mini Cheesecake

Okay, so you’ve got the basic steps down, but I’ve picked up a few little tricks over the years that really elevate these no-bake wonders from “good” to “OMG, you HAVE to try these!”

  • Room Temperature is Your Best Friend: Seriously, I can’t stress this enough for the cream cheese. If it’s cold, you’ll end up with lumps, and nobody wants lumpy cheesecake! Pull it out of the fridge at least an hour before you start.
  • Whip That Cream Cold: On the flip side, make sure your heavy cream is super cold when you whip it. I even pop my mixing bowl and whisk attachment in the freezer for 10 minutes beforehand. It makes for much sturdier, fluffier whipped cream!
  • Don’t Skimp on Chilling Time: I know, it’s tough to wait, but those 4 hours (or even better, overnight!) are essential. It allows the cheesecake to firm up properly so it holds its shape and tastes absolutely divine. Patience is a virtue, especially in no-bake desserts!
  • Press That Crust Firmly: A well-packed crust means it won’t crumble when you try to eat it. Use the bottom of a glass or your fingers to really get it compressed.

No Bake Turtle Mini Cheesecake: Storage and Serving Suggestions

You’ve made these incredible mini cheesecakes, now how do you keep them perfect? For any leftovers (if there even are any!), just pop them into an airtight container and keep them in the fridge. They’ll stay wonderfully fresh and delicious for up to 3-4 days. When it’s time to serve, I always pull them out of the fridge about 15-20 minutes beforehand. This lets them warm up just a tiny bit, making that creamy filling even more luscious and those toppings just sing!

Can I make No Bake Turtle Mini Cheesecake ahead of time?

Oh, absolutely! In fact, I highly recommend it. These cheesecakes are perfect for making a day or even two days in advance. They actually firm up even better and the flavors have more time to meld and get super delicious. Just keep them covered in the fridge until you’re ready to serve, and then add your toppings right before company arrives!

What if I don’t have mini cheesecake pans for my No Bake Turtle Mini Cheesecake?

No worries at all! Muffin tins are your best friend here. Just line a regular 12-cup muffin tin with paper liners, and press your crust mixture into the bottom of each one. They’ll still be adorable and perfectly portioned mini cheesecakes. You can also use small ramekins if you have them, just be sure to lightly grease them first!

Can I use a different type of crust for this No Bake Turtle Mini Cheesecake?

You totally can! While graham cracker is classic, feel free to get creative. Crushed chocolate cookies (like those famous sandwich cookies!), shortbread cookies, or even pretzels for a sweet and salty twist would be fantastic. Just make sure whatever you choose, you crush it finely and mix it with melted butter to form a cohesive crust.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 1/2 cups graham cracker crumbs
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 16 ounces cream cheese, softened
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on alcohol-free vanilla extract
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1/2 cup caramel sauce
  • 1/4 cup chocolate syrup
  • 1/4 cup chopped pecans

Instructions

  1. Combine graham cracker crumbs, granulated sugar, and melted butter in a medium bowl. Press the mixture into the bottom of 12 mini cheesecake pans or cupcake liners.
  2. Beat cream cheese, powdered sugar, and alcohol-free vanilla extract in a large bowl until smooth.
  3. In a separate bowl, whip heavy cream until stiff peaks form. Gently f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ture.
  4. Divide the cheesecake mixture evenly among the prepared crusts.
  5. Chill the cheesecakes for at least 4 hours, or until firm.
  6. Before serving, drizzle with caramel sauce and chocolate syrup, then sprinkle with chopped pecans.

Notes

  • For best results, use full-fat cream cheese.
  • Ensure all ingredients are at room temperature for a smoother cheesecake filling.
  • You can prepare these cheesecakes a day in advance.
